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ration
- Warped Floors or Walls – Moisture weakens the structure, causing wood and drywall to warp. If left untreated, this can lead to costly flooring and drywall replacement.
- Musty Odors – A lingering damp smell often indicates hidden mold. Even if mold is not visible, it could be growing behind walls or under carpets.
- Visible Mold Growth – Even a small mold spot can indicate a larger issue behind walls or under floors. Mold thrives in moisture-rich environments, making immediate intervention essential.
- Peeling Paint or Wallpaper – Excess moisture causes adhesion issues, leading to peeling surfaces. This is often an early sign of hidden water damage.
-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ls – This could be a sign of an active leak needing immediate attention. Over time, stains can darken, indicating an ongoing issue.

How Mold Spreads
Mold spores are microscopic and travel through the air, landing on surfaces where moisture is present. High humidity areas such as basements, bathrooms, and attics are prime breeding grounds. Once mold starts growing, it releases even more spores, leading to widespread contamination. This is why mold removal requires not only surface cleaning but also moisture elimination and air purification to prevent regrowth.

Common Questions About Water Damage & Mold Removal
How Long Does It Take for Mold to Grow After Water Damage?
Mold can begin forming within 24-48 hours of water exposure. That’s why immediate drying and dehumidification are crucial. Even if water damage appears minimal, hidden moisture can fuel mold growth behind walls or under flooring.
Can I Clean Mold Myself?
Small mold patches on non-porous surfaces may be cleaned with a bleach solution. However, large-scale mold growth or mold on porous materials like drywall requires professional remediation to prevent cross-contamination. DIY mold removal can often disturb spores, spreading them further into your home.
What Are the Health Risks of Mold Exposure?
Exposure to mold can cause coughing, sneezing, throat irritation, and skin rashes. Individuals with asthma or weakened immune systems may experience more severe reactions. Long-term exposure to toxic mold can lead to chronic respiratory issues and other serious health problems.
Is Water Damage Covered by Homeowners Insurance?
Insurance coverage depends on the cause of the water damage. Sudden leaks or burst pipes may be covered, but gradual leaks or flood damage may require additional coverage. It’s best to review your policy and contact your provider for clarification.
How Can I Prevent Water Damage in the Future?
- Regularly inspect plumbing and fix leaks immediately.
- Ensure gutters and downspouts are clear of debris.
- Use dehumidifiers in high-humidity areas like basements.
- Seal windows and doors to prevent leaks.
- Schedule regular maintenance checks for HVAC and water heaters.
